Receiving the very best quote on your own dumpster

One of the greatest concerns you likely have when renting a dumpster in Brookfield is how much it will cost. Among the best methods to negate this anxiety is to have precise information. When you phone to get a price quote, have a good idea of how much waste you'll have to get rid of so you can get the very best recommendation on dumpster size. In case you are not sure on the quantity of waste, renting a size larger will save you the added expense of renting a second dumpster if the first proves overly little.

Supply any information you believe is relevant to be sure you don't end up paying for services that you don't really need. More than a few companies charge by the container size, while others charge by weight. Be sure you understand which is which so you've a clear quote. Also ensure that you ask whether the quote you receive comprises landfill coststhis is going to keep you from being surprised by an additional fee after.

A few Things You Can Not Put into Your Dumpster

Although the specific rules that regulate what you can and cannot contain in a dumpster change from area to area, there are several kinds of substances that most dumpster rental service in Brookfields WOn't allow. A number of the things which you commonly cannot set in the dumpster contain:

Batteries, particularly the kind that include mercury Automotive fluids like used motor oil, engine coolants, and transmission fluid Pesticides and herbicides that could pollute groundwater Paints and solvents (they contain oils and other compounds that may damage the environment) Electronics, especially those that include batteries There are also some mattresses you could normally set in your dumpster provided that you are willing to pay an additional fee. These include: Appliances Mattresses Tires

When in doubt, it is best to contact your rental company to get a record of stuff that you just can't place into the dumpster.


Can I Use a Rolloff Dumpster in a Residential Area?

Most residential areas enable rolloff dumpsters. If you have a drive, then you can normally park the dumpster there so you do not annoy your neighbors or cause traffic problems by placing it on the street.

Some jobs, though, will require setting the dumpster on the road. If it applies to you, then you definitely need to speak to your city to find out whether you need to get any licenses before renting the dumpster. In most cases, cities will allow you to keep a dumpster on a residential street for a short period of time. In case you believe you'll need to be sure that it stays to the street for several weeks or months, though, you might need to get a permit.

Contacting your local licenses and licensing office is usually recommended. Even supposing it's an unnecessary precaution, at least you'll realize that you simply are following the law.

What Types of Debris Can I Place Into a Dumpster?

It's possible for you to put most types of debris into a dumpster rental in Brookfield. There are, however, some exceptions. For instance, you cannot put chemicals into a dumpster. That includes motor oil, paints, solvents, automotive fluids, pesticides, and cleaning agents. Electronics and batteries are also prohibited. If something introduces an environmental hazard, you likely cannot set it in a dumpster. Contact your rental company if you're unsure.

That leaves most types of debris that you could set in the dumpster, include drywall, concrete, lumber, and yard waste. Pretty much any type of debris left from a construction job can go in the dumpster.

Particular types of acceptable debris, however, may require additional fees. In case you plan to throw away used tires, mattresses, or appliances, you should ask the rental company whether you have to pay another fee. Adding these to your dumpster may cost anywhere from $25 to $100, depending on the thing.


What are the Various Sizes of Dumpsters Available?

Determined by the size of your job, you might need a little or large dumpster that could carry all of the debris and leftover materials.

Dumpster rental firms usually provide several sizes for people and companies. Choosing the right size should help you remove debris as affordably as possible.

The most typical dumpsters comprise 10-yard, 20-yard, 30-yard, and 40-yard versions. Should you are in possession of a little job, for example clearing out a garage or cellar, you can likely benefit from a 10-yard or 20-yard dumpster. Should you have a bigger job, for example an entire remodel or building a new home, then you will likely need a 30-yard or 40-yard dumpster.

A lot of people choose to rent a bigger dumpster than they think they'll want. Although renting a bigger dumpster prices more cash, it is more economical than having to an additional dumpster after a little one gets full.

Dumpster Rental in Brookfield Prices: Flat Rate vs Per Ton

In the event you're looking to rent a dumpster in Brookfield, one of your primary concerns is going to be price. There are generally two pricing options available when renting a dumpster in Brookfield. Flat rate is pricing dependent on the size of the dumpster, not the amount of material you place in it. Per ton pricing will charge you based on the weight you need hauled.

One type of pricing structure isn't necessarily more expensive than the other. Knowing exactly how much material you need to throw away, you might get a better deal with per short ton pricing. On the other hand, flat rate pricing can assist you to keep a limitation on costs when you're coping with unknown weights. Dumpster Sizes Available Brookfield

Get started in less than 60 seconds. Pick up the phone and get a quote now!

 

10 Yard

Great for small projects

  • 12 feet long
  • 8 feet wide
  • 4 feet tall
Popular

20 Yard

For moderate sized cleanouts

  • 22 feet long
  • 8 feet wide
  • 4.5 feet tall
 

30 Yard

All around good dumpster size

  • 22 foot long
  • 8 feet wide
  • 6 feet tall
 

40 Yard

For the largest projects

  • 22 foot long
  • 8 feet wide
  • 8 feet tall

*Dimensions & availability may vary by location. Call to confirm.
